Etsy – the online market place Etsy is an online ecommerce market place where designer/makers can easily set-up an online shop to sell their wares. Etsy is known for its handmade goods and fun items. The ease of set-up means there are a large number of people selling items on Etsy, and that includes a lot of vegans. home » posts » guides Introduction On the face of it, gardening appears to be a gentle, benign pastime close to nature. But take a walk around any garden centre and you will see a large number of products made with slaughterhouse by-products, products for killing various creatures, or products that are damaging to the environment or otherwise unsustainable. This does not sit comfortably with those of us who follow a vegan philosophy, and others who are trying to find ways to be kinder to the Earth. It seems that almost every day we see reports in the news about how bees are in decline, and that something needs to be done to help bees. Public concern over the issue is at a high level. Even vegans are advocating creating honeybee hives, even if not to consume their honey. But is this the best way to help bees? Are we even concerned about the right species?
